Released January 1st, 1987, 'The Nativity' stars Gregory Harrison, Helen Hunt, Vincent Price, David Ackroyd The movie has a runtime of about 30 min, and received a user score of 75 (out of 100) on TMDb, which collated reviews from 2 well-known users.
What, so now you want to know what the movie's about? Here's the plot: "The Nativity is seen through the eyes of three young visitors from the 20th century who are transported back through time to the Holy City" .
